Sanderling
[Calidris alba]

[Length 8 in. Wingspan 17 in.]

Sanderlings may be the best known of all the sandpipers. Who has not watched them on beaches running before an incoming wave only to turn immediately and chase the wave as it recedes? This is how they feed, for their prey (sand worms and other invertebrates) must constantly rebuild the entrances to their tunnels with each new wave. During that brief time, they are vulnerable to the Sanderlings. This small group was photographed as they landed on the beach along the central New Jersey coast.
